2017 Annual Meeting
(300a) Basbl: Branch-and-Sandwich Bilevel Solver. Implementation and Computational Study Using Basblib Test Set
Authors
In this talk, we discuss BASBL, an implementation of the deterministic global optimization algorithm Branch-and-Sandwich for mixed-integer nonconvex/nonlinear bilevel problems, within the open-source MINOTAUR framework [7]. The solver stems from the original Branch-and-Sandwich algorithm [3, 4] and modifications proposed in our recent works [5, 6]. We also introduce BASBLib, an extensive online library of bilevel benchmark problems collected from the literature. The library is designed to enable contributions from the bilevel optimization community. We use the problems from BASBLib, including problems derived from practical applications, to study the performance of BASBL using different algorithmic options, including a variety of bounding schemes, branching, and node selection strategies.
References
- Biegler, L.T., Grossmann, I.E.: Retrospective on optimization. Comput. Chem. Eng. 28, 1169â1192 (2004).
- Floudas, C.A., Gounaris, C.E. A review of recent advances in global optimization. J Glob Optim, 45, 3â28 (2009)
- Kleniati, P.-M., Adjiman, C.S.: Branch-and-Sandwich: a deterministic global optimization algorithm for optimistic bilevel programming problems. Part I: Theoretical development. J Glob Optim, 60(3), 425â458 (2014).
- Kleniati, P.-M., Adjiman, C.S.: Branch-and-Sandwich: a deterministic global optimization algorithm for optimistic bilevel programming problems. Part II: Convergence analysis and numerical results. J Glob Optim, 60(3), 459â481 (2014).
- PaulaviÄius, R. and Adjiman, C.S.: BASBL: Branch-And-Sandwich BiLevel solver. I. Algorithmic improvements and extensions, (2017). Submitted.
- PaulaviÄius, R., Kleniati, P.-M., and Adjiman, C.S. BASBL: Branch-And-Sandwich BiLevel solver. II. Implementation and computational study with the BASBLib test set, (2017). Submitted.
- Mahajan, A., Leyffer, S., Munson, T., Linderoth, J., Luedtke, J.: MINOTAUR: Toolkit for Mixed Integer Nonlinear Optimization Problems, http://wiki.mcs.anl.gov/minotaur/index.php/Main_Page.Â